About The Position

Boater’s World Marine Centers is actively expanding our team at our Lake Placid, FL location as we enter peak boating season. With 100+ boats arriving monthly through retail and consignment, we are seeking an experienced and highly organized Lot Manager to take ownership of lot operations, inventory flow, and overall organization. This role is critical to dealership success — ensuring all units are properly staged, accessible, and moved efficiently to support Sales, Service, and delivery timelines.

Responsibilities

  • Oversee daily lot operations, ensuring all units are properly organized, staged, and accessible
  • Maintain a clean, structured, and customer-ready lot at all times
  • Implement and maintain systems for tracking high-volume inventory
  • Manage incoming inventory including retail units, consignments, and inter-store transfers
  • Coordinate timely movement of boats between Sales, Service, and delivery schedules
  • Ensure accurate placement and quick retrieval of all units on site
  • Provide direction to Lot Porters and support staff as needed
  • Delegate tasks to ensure efficiency and coverage across the lot
  • Work cross-functionally with Sales, Service, and Parts to prioritize workload
  • Safely move, position, and stage boats, trailers, and equipment across the property
  • Oversee loading/unloading processes to ensure safety and efficiency
  • Assist with receiving units and verifying condition upon arrival
  • Monitor lot inventory for damage, missing items, or inconsistencies
  • Ensure all units are properly staged and accounted for
